UV-B phototherapy clears psoriasis through local effects.

Robert S Dawe1, Heather Cameron, Susan Yule

  • 1Photobiology Unit, Department of Dermatology, University of Dundee, Ninewells Hospital and Medical School, Dundee, Scotland. r.s.dawe@dundee.ac.uk

Archives of Dermatology
|August 8, 2002
PubMed
Summary

UV-B phototherapy primarily improves psoriasis through local effects, not systemic ones. Any systemic impact is minimal and not clinically significant for chronic plaque psoriasis treatment.

Area of Science:

  • Dermatology
  • Phototherapy Research

Background:

  • Psoriasis is a chronic inflammatory skin condition.
  • UV-B phototherapy is a common treatment for psoriasis.

Purpose of the Study:

  • To investigate whether UV-B phototherapy exerts systemic effects in clearing psoriasis.
  • To differentiate between local and systemic contributions of UV-B therapy to psoriasis improvement.

Main Methods:

  • A randomized, within-subject design comparing three plaques in patients undergoing UV-B therapy.
  • Control plaques were covered during treatment, while others were exposed.
  • Psoriasis severity was assessed using the scaling, erythema, and induration (SEI) score.

Main Results:

  • UV-B-treated plaques showed significant improvement (mean SEI score decrease of 7.6) compared to covered plaques (mean decrease of 3.2).

  • Control plaques (awaiting UV-B) showed minimal improvement (mean SEI decrease of 0.4) over 3 weeks.
  • Covered plaques in treated patients showed a small improvement (mean decrease of 1.4) compared to controls.
  • Conclusions:

    • UV-B phototherapy's efficacy in chronic plaque psoriasis is predominantly due to local effects.
    • Any potential systemic effects of UV-B phototherapy are small and clinically insignificant.
    • Findings support the interpretation of phototherapy studies focusing on local treatment responses.
